3 Ingredients
fresh spinach, 4 cups, rinsed applesauce, unsweetened yellow cake mix, your favorite boxed cake mix making cupcakes? then you will need frosting and sprinkles too.
Let’s Make Green Spinach Cupcakes
Add spinach and applesauce into a food processor. Blend until the mixture becomes pureed. Add the cake mix to a mixing bowl with the spinach puree, beating with a hand mixer until completely combined. Fill baking cups in cupcake pan with the batter. Bake for around 20 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ean. Let cool before popping them out of the cupcake tins. You can serve these up as muffins right away, or decorate with frosting and sprinkles to make cupcakes. These are my favorite sprinkles to use!
Freezing Spinach Muffins
You can easily freeze these spinach muffins to keep on hand for quick breakfast and snack options! Simply allow to cool and then freeze on a baking sheet for about 30 minutes. After they’re frozen, transfer to a freezer bag and freeze They are good this way for 3-4 months. As you need them, take them out of the freezer and defrost in the microwave until fully thawed.
